Transaction 62a29e56e8fe570d59f420df0f494fa891c1f6a219c972ecdfab6ecac5e44dd9
1 Input
2 Outputs
- 62a29e56e8fe570d59f420df0f494fa891c1f6a219c972ecdfab6ecac5e44dd9:0
- 62a29e56e8fe570d59f420df0f494fa891c1f6a219c972ecdfab6ecac5e44dd9:1
value 168588
address 1Zy18JLTtGwSiagX7YMaS6oZdocVEqkf4
value 399828700
address 34LY8PqympGjApG1woXjcG2P4rAs1YHJAa